Sugar waxing at home




Sugaring hair removal recipe:

2 cups white cane sugar
1/4 cup lemon juice
1/4 cup water

The juice from two lemons gave me 1/4 cup, but be sure to strain it to rid any pulp or seeds. You could probably use lemon juice concentrate as well.
Mix ingredients in a heavy sauce pan over a medium-high heat. Stir the mixture often so that it doesn't overheat at the bottom.
This recipe can be used for both face and body sugaring. Many people are turning to this hair removal method because it's more gentle to the skin and less painful than waxing.
After it comes to a boil, turn the heat down to low-medium and simmer for 25 minutes. This length of time is needed to get the final product just right. If it's not cooked long enough, the end sugar hair removal product will be too sticky to work with.
After 25 minutes of simmering, the sugar hair removal result should be a dark amber color. Remove it from the heat and let it cool for about ten minutes .


Now apply little talcum powder where you want to remove the hair. Then spread the sugar paste there slowly with a stick . Take a thick denim cloth and stick over the place and pull in the opposite direction gently. You should use talcum powder first. This is comparitively less painful than any other methods of hair removal and there is no chemicals also. Try it at home.

Did It Turn Out Too Hard?

A couple of people have emailed me saying that the product turned out way too hard. If that happens you Put one tablespoon of water into the mixture and microwave it until it gets hot- which may be a couple of minutes. Remove from microwave and stir. Let it cool down a bit to use as sugaring gel or completely cool to use as sugaring paste.

Thyroid - Hypothyroid - Meaning - Causes - Symptoms - Treatment

What is Hypothyroid? Hypothyroidism is a condition in which the body lacks sufficient thyroid hormone. Since the main purpose of thyroid hormone is to "run the body's metabolism," it is understandable that people with this condition will have symptoms associated with a slow metabolism. Causes About three percent of the general population is hypothyroidic. Factors such as iodine deficiency or exposure to Iodine can increase that risk. There are a number of causes for hypothyroidism. Iodine deficiency is the most common cause of hypothyroidism worldwide. In iodine-replete individuals hypothyroidism is generally caused by Hashimoto's thyroiditis, or otherwise as a result of either an absent thyroid gland or a deficiency in stimulating hormones from the hypothalamus or pituitary.

Back pain - Meaning- causes - Exercises

The lower spine consists of five bones, called the lumbar vertebrae. The vertebrae support the body and protect the spinal core and nerves. Between each vertebra is a disk filled with a jelly-like material. The disks act as shock absorbers for the vertebrae. Along the spine are many nerves. Injury to these nerves can cause pain. What can cause low back injuries? Many things can cause low back injuries - muscle strain or spasm, sprains of ligaments (which attach bone to bone), joint problems or a "slipped disk." The most common cause of low back pain is using your back muscles in activities you're not used to, like lifting heavy furniture, playing basketball or doing yard work. A slipped disk happens when the disk between the bones bulges and presses on nerves. This is often caused by twisting while lifting. But many people won't know what caused their slipped disk.
